Ticket: BRANCHREAPER-29 — The stale-branch cleanup bot failed its signature check when pushing deletion manifests to the Fernhollow release repo. Investigation shows the bot's deploy credential was rotated during last week's maintenance window, but the updated value never reached the bot's vault path. I have confirmed the manifest contents are correct and untampered; only the credential is stale. Release manager: please approve redeployment once the secret is restored. The replacement value for the vault entry follows.

release key, fahaf-bajof: bky3_Xam

Subject: Project Tallow — Delay Update

Team, brief status for finance. Tallow slips six weeks. Root cause: vendor integration rework on the Greyfield module. Budget impact estimated at 4% over baseline; revised forecast attached. No change to headcount. Dependencies on the Q4 billing migration are now at risk and flagged amber. Decision needed by Friday on whether to descope reporting phase two. Recommendation and context are in the confidential note below.

board note of kageg-bahof: The renewal with Holwynax Holdings closes at $2 million a year, 5 percent below the last contract. Project Ulaath slips by two quarters because of the supplier delay.

# Artifact Signing — TumbleStash Locker Flow

All firmware and app bundles for the TumbleStash laundry-locker access flow are signed at build time. Unsigned or mis-signed bundles cause lockers to refuse unlock requests and show error L-12. When a customer reports L-12, first confirm their locker is on a current signed build via the admin panel; do not push builds manually. Escalate anything older than two releases. To verify a bundle yourself, run `stash-verify` against the file using the public key below.

release key, kahif-yagap: bky3_1JN

Hey Priya,

Handing over the template rendering perf work on Quillcast. Short version: we cache compiled templates per tenant now, which cut p95 render time by 60%. Worth a security look since cache keys include tenant slugs — no user input flows in, but verify for yourself. Everything tunable lives in one place; the renderer boots with these configuration values.

config for tagef-bahip:
eliael:
  pin: 1924
  tenant: gilys
  seal: seal_b0b00e0d
  metrics_host: metrics.eliael.ferraforge.corp
  standby_team: gilok
  escalation: ulair-ulaael
  nonce: 965f6e